Crowded RB rotation: Elliott breaks down the snaps

Offensive coordinator and running backs coach Tony Elliott took a long and hard look at his position group during Wednesday’s full-scale scrimmage in Death Valley and even he doesn’t know who will be the starter next season. What he does know is that his current roster of six running backs means someone won’t get carries once the season starts. Full Story »

Davidson feels like the odd man out


Mar 27, 2015, 2:00 PM

And perhaps Fuller is still green. I can see where Gallman/Dye/Brooks get the most snaps, and depending on who is hot and when, one of them may get the most.

After them, I would think Choice would be next depending on how healthy he is and stays. And then Fuller/Davidson would be fighting for the tail end of the depth chart.

I know people will cry "turnover machine", but I still think Davidson's best shot at seeing the field this season will be in some other role. Kick returns is my choice if he can prove to be able to keep the ball secure. Just learn to carry it differently.

If Brooks got stronger in his lower body during the redshirt


Mar 27, 2015, 5:44 PM

year, I could see him stepping up. He has great speed. If he can develop his lower body strength and learn to run a bit lower and with better leverage, like Dye and Choice, and much as Gallman needs to do, he could really step up his game this year. He has excellent speed, hands and height. If he can add power to his game, which should help his pass blocking, he could be one of the top 2-3 backs.

Gallman and Dye will battle for the starter's role, with Dye ending the season in front, with Gallman and Brooks alternating at the second spot, and Fuller next. I would expect Choice to redshirt, though he might be top 3 if healthy this year, leaving Davidson to get limited carries.
